MicroLogic Active Measurement Availability and Display
Presentation
The available measurements depend on the type of MicroLogic Active control unit:
-
MicroLogic Active A/AP control unit measures currents only.
-
MicroLogic Active E/EP/Ei control unit measures currents and voltages.
The measurements can be displayed :
-
On the MicroLogic Active display screen
-
On the FDM121 display
-
With Panel Server Zigbee connectivity: on Panel Server webpages and on remote controllers connected to Panel Server, through Zigbee wireless communication (MicroLogic Active AP/EP control unit only)
-
On a server or remote controller using the wired communication network
-
On IFE/EIFE webpages
The following tables indicate which measurements are available on each type of display option.
